The Evolution of Rap: From the Bronx to Global Domination
Beginning from the district of the Bronx throughout the 1970s, rap the genre initially embodied a grassroots expression of adversity and joy . Pioneering DJs, like Kool Herc, utilized turntables to manipulate rhythmic patterns, creating a innovative sonic space for MCs to rap . What began as a social movement confined to block parties gradually broadened across the United States and, eventually , the world, transforming evolving into a worldwide phenomenon and a significant force across popular entertainment. The ascent of rap reflects a compelling story of musical innovation and its ability to overcome geographical limitations .

The Greatest Conflicts: A Chronicle of Beef
From the origins of rap music, fierce disputes have been an integral part of its landscape. Early clashes, like a Kool Moe Dee versus MC Shan battle – fueled by the infamous "Bridge Wars" – established a standard for what was to follow. The infamous rap East Coast versus West Coast rivalry in the mid-90s, involving stars like Tupac Shakur and The Notorious B.I.G., remains arguably the definitive and tragic copyrightple, resulting in a lasting impact on the genre. More latter beefs, such as Drake versus Meek Mill and Pusha T versus Kanye West, have illustrated that this tradition of lyrical battling remains a important force in shaping the direction of hip-hop.
The Impact of Rap on Fashion and Culture
Rap hip-hop has profoundly altered modern fashion and broader culture. Initially, original rap performers embraced streetwear styles, like baggy clothing, sneakers , and flashy jewelry, which quickly imitated by followers and transitioned to defining elements of a scene. This relationship continued as rap evolved , leading to collaborations with luxury brands and fueling looks that resonate far beyond the art itself, cementing rap’s powerful influence on the world .
